Mercy Charism Cross for 2012


This week we have been lucky enough to have a member of our class awarded the Mercy Charism cross for the first time in 2012.



Our Mercy Charism qualities are:
  • Being Fair and Just
  • Caring for others
  • Trust in God
  • Welcoming
  • Serving others
  • Love and Compassion
During the week anyone that is demonstrating qualities from our Mercy Charism is given a token to put into the Mercy Charism box.

 
Each week a name is drawn out of the special wooden box made by Alex and Annie Armstrong's dad. The cross remains in the class of the child it is awarded to until the next assembly.  A Mercy cross is also given to the class to hang above the prayer table for the week.

Move, Mprove - gymnastics

This term Rooms 1,2, 3 and 5 were lucky enough to take part in the ‘Move Mprove’ gymnastics programme run by Gymnastics Southland.  We learned how to correctly complete a forward roll, as well as jumping, landing, balancing and strengthening skills.



  One of the other important skills we learned was to persevere, and keep trying.  As the weeks progressed we all improved and we have become a lot more confident.   


The smiles on our faces at the end of each session showed how much we enjoyed the activities.
